Get ready for the concert of the year! Young musos of the Tweed are getting ready to rock at the Youth Music Venture grand finale showcase concert at Seagulls Club, Tweed Heads West on Sunday 18 June.

Youth Music Venture (YMV), a volunteer organisation, provides programs that cater for young people wanting to experience what it’s like to be part of a band.

This is the second year YMV has operated in the Tweed. The free program, which began on the Gold Coast in 2009, is open to young people in our community aged 11 to 17 years.

Three bands from the venture will perform at the YMV showcase event which will be emceed by The Voice Australia’s Chang Po Ching.

Each band has already undergone 8 weeks of mentoring from their own musical mentors, themselves esteemed musicians, to show them the ropes and help develop their skills in a professional environment.

YMV founder Ian Grace thanked Council and Seagulls Club for their support for the program, which continues to grow year by year.

“It is just wonderful to see young musical talent recognised and nurtured in a way that fosters skills, personal growth and most importantly lots of confidence in the young people involved,” Mr Grace said.

Council’s Community Development Officer for Youth and Social Planning Amanda Micallef said Council was proud to back the initiative, which gave young people the opportunity to thrive in a unique environment.

“We are proud to support opportunities like Youth Music Venture that support our young people and help them kick goals, whatever they may be,” Ms Micaleff said.

“Not many young people get the opportunity to perform like rock stars in front of a live audience!”
